Help Orla See Past Retinoblastoma
Just before her 2nd birthday, our sweet Orla was diagnosed with retinoblastoma, a rare eye cancer found in children. On the best advice of her doctors and after talking to other families who have been through it, we decided the best chance to cure her cancer completely was to remove her eye. There is a very small chance that some cancer remains, in which case she will need to receive systemic chemotherapy to treat it. Within the next month, Orla will receive a new prosthetic eye and will require ongoing adjustments and additional prosthetic replacements as she grows into adulthood.
